Skip to content

Commit

Permalink
style(*):format doc
Browse files Browse the repository at this point in the history
  • Loading branch information
zhaoweilong007 committed Nov 23, 2021
1 parent cf2a261 commit 550c048
Show file tree
Hide file tree
Showing 33 changed files with 1,975 additions and 1,297 deletions.
72 changes: 40 additions & 32 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-7,52 +7,60 @@
> [推荐在线阅读](http://doc.hkxx.icu)
## 序章
- [介绍](foreword/介绍.md)
- [计划](foreword/计划.md)

- [介绍](foreword/介绍.md)
- [计划](foreword/计划.md)

## 笔记
- [java知识点总结](notes/java知识点总结.md)
- [Java常见面试题](notes/java常见面试题.md)
- [SpringCloud学习笔记](notes/SpringCloud学习笔记.md)
- [kubernates学习笔记](notes/kubernates学习笔记.md)
- [elasticSearch学习笔记](notes/elasticSearch学习笔记.md)
- [redis笔记](/notes/redis.md)
- [mysql笔记](/notes/mysql.md)
- [docker笔记](/notes/docker.md)
- [kubernates笔记](/notes/kubernates学习笔记.md)
- [dubbo笔记](/notes/docker.md)
- [rockerMQ笔记](/notes/rocketMQ.md)
- [rabbitMQ笔记](/notes/rabbitMQ.md)
- [kafka笔记](/notes/kafka.md)


- [java知识点总结](notes/java知识点总结.md)
- [Java常见面试题](notes/java常见面试题.md)
- [SpringCloud学习笔记](notes/SpringCloud学习笔记.md)
- [kubernates学习笔记](notes/kubernates学习笔记.md)
- [elasticSearch学习笔记](notes/elasticSearch学习笔记.md)
- [redis笔记](/notes/redis.md)
- [mysql笔记](/notes/mysql.md)
- [docker笔记](/notes/docker.md)
- [kubernates笔记](/notes/kubernates学习笔记.md)
- [dubbo笔记](/notes/docker.md)
- [rockerMQ笔记](/notes/rocketMQ.md)
- [rabbitMQ笔记](/notes/rabbitMQ.md)
- [kafka笔记](/notes/kafka.md)
- [seata笔记](/notes/seata.md)

## 博客
- [elasticSearch入门教程](/blog/elasticSearch入门教程.md)
- [rocketMQ入门教程](/blog/rocketMQ入门教程.md)
- [dubbo快速入门](/blog/dubbo快速入门)
- [seata分布式事务使用](/blog/seata分布式事务使用.md)
- [使用harbo搭建docker私有仓库](/blog/harbor教程.md)
- [使用portainer管理docker镜像](/blog/portainer教程.md)
- [docker-compose使用](/blog/docker-compose教程.md)

- [elasticSearch入门教程](/blog/elasticSearch入门教程.md)
- [rocketMQ入门教程](/blog/rocketMQ入门教程.md)
- [dubbo快速入门](/blog/dubbo快速入门)
- [seata分布式事务使用](/blog/seata分布式事务使用.md)
- [使用harbo搭建docker私有仓库](/blog/harbor教程.md)
- [使用portainer管理docker镜像](/blog/portainer教程.md)
- [docker-compose使用](/blog/docker-compose教程.md)

## 工具
- [window下的linux子系统](/tool/window下的linux子系统.md)
- [ZSH-最好看的shell](/tool/最好看的shell.md)
- [idea常用插件](/tool/idea常用插件.md)
- [vim简明教程](/tool/vim简明教程.md)
- [Arthas-强大Java诊断利器](/tool/强大的java诊断利器.md)
- [window的包管理器scoop](/tool/window的包管理器.md)
- [utool提升你的开发效率](/tool/utool提升你的开发效率.md)

- [window下的linux子系统](/tool/window下的linux子系统.md)
- [ZSH-最好看的shell](/tool/最好看的shell.md)
- [idea常用插件](/tool/idea常用插件.md)
- [vim简明教程](/tool/vim简明教程.md)
- [Arthas-强大Java诊断利器](/tool/强大的java诊断利器.md)
- [window的包管理器scoop](/tool/window的包管理器.md)
- [utool提升你的开发效率](/tool/utool提升你的开发效率.md)

## 其他
- [安卓如何获得ROOT权限](/other/安卓如何获得ROOT权限.md)
- [科学上网的正确姿势](/other/clash的使用.md)

- [安卓如何获得ROOT权限](/other/安卓如何获得ROOT权限.md)
- [科学上网的正确姿势](/other/clash的使用.md)

## 捐赠

🏆如果对你有帮助,请作者吃根热狗🌭

<img src="http://doc.hkxx.icu/images/pay.png" width = "250" height = "250" />

## 联系我

😜扫码添加作者微信

<img src="http://doc.hkxx.icu/images/weixin.jpg" width = "250" height = "250" />
65 changes: 33 additions & 32 deletions _sidebar.md
Original file line number Diff line number Diff line change
@@ -1,40 +1,41 @@
* 序章
* [介绍](foreword/介绍.md)
* [计划](foreword/计划.md)
* [介绍](foreword/介绍.md)
* [计划](foreword/计划.md)

* 笔记
* [java知识点总结](notes/java知识点总结.md)
* [Java常见面试题](notes/java常见面试题.md)
* [SpringCloud学习笔记](notes/SpringCloud学习笔记.md)
* [kubernates学习笔记](notes/kubernates学习笔记.md)
* [elasticSearch学习笔记](notes/elasticSearch学习笔记.md)
* [redis笔记](/notes/redis.md)
* [mysql笔记](/notes/mysql.md)
* [docker笔记](/notes/docker.md)
* [kubernates笔记](/notes/kubernates学习笔记.md)
* [dubbo笔记](/notes/docker.md)
* [rockerMQ笔记](/notes/rocketMQ.md)
* [rabbitMQ笔记](/notes/rabbitMQ.md)
* [kafka笔记](/notes/kafka.md)

* [java知识点总结](notes/java知识点总结.md)
* [Java常见面试题](notes/java常见面试题.md)
* [SpringCloud学习笔记](notes/SpringCloud学习笔记.md)
* [kubernates学习笔记](notes/kubernates学习笔记.md)
* [elasticSearch学习笔记](notes/elasticSearch学习笔记.md)
* [redis笔记](/notes/redis.md)
* [mysql笔记](/notes/mysql.md)
* [docker笔记](/notes/docker.md)
* [kubernates笔记](/notes/kubernates学习笔记.md)
* [dubbo笔记](/notes/docker.md)
* [rockerMQ笔记](/notes/rocketMQ.md)
* [rabbitMQ笔记](/notes/rabbitMQ.md)
* [kafka笔记](/notes/kafka.md)
* [seata笔记](/notes/seata.md)

* 博客
* [elasticSearch入门教程](/blog/elasticSearch入门教程.md)
* [rocketMQ入门教程](/blog/rocketMQ入门教程.md)
* [dubbo快速入门](/blog/dubbo快速入门)
* [seata分布式事务使用](/blog/seata分布式事务使用.md)
* [使用harbo搭建docker私有仓库](/blog/harbor教程.md)
* [使用portainer管理docker镜像](/blog/portainer教程.md)
* [docker-compose使用](/blog/docker-compose教程.md)
* [elasticSearch入门教程](/blog/elasticSearch入门教程.md)
* [rocketMQ入门教程](/blog/rocketMQ入门教程.md)
* [dubbo快速入门](/blog/dubbo快速入门)
* [seata分布式事务使用](/blog/seata分布式事务使用.md)
* [使用harbo搭建docker私有仓库](/blog/harbor教程.md)
* [使用portainer管理docker镜像](/blog/portainer教程.md)
* [docker-compose使用](/blog/docker-compose教程.md)

* 工具
* [window下的linux子系统](/tool/window下的linux子系统.md)
* [ZSH-最好看的shell](/tool/最好看的shell.md)
* [idea常用插件](/tool/idea常用插件.md)
* [vim简明教程](/tool/vim简明教程.md)
* [Arthas-强大Java诊断利器](/tool/强大的java诊断利器.md)
* [window的包管理器scoop](/tool/window的包管理器.md)
* [utool提升你的开发效率](/tool/utool提升你的开发效率.md)
* [window下的linux子系统](/tool/window下的linux子系统.md)
* [ZSH-最好看的shell](/tool/最好看的shell.md)
* [idea常用插件](/tool/idea常用插件.md)
* [vim简明教程](/tool/vim简明教程.md)
* [Arthas-强大Java诊断利器](/tool/强大的java诊断利器.md)
* [window的包管理器scoop](/tool/window的包管理器.md)
* [utool提升你的开发效率](/tool/utool提升你的开发效率.md)

* 其他
* [安卓如何获得ROOT权限](/other/安卓如何获得ROOT权限.md)
* [科学上网的正确姿势](/other/科学上网的正确姿势.md)
* [安卓如何获得ROOT权限](/other/安卓如何获得ROOT权限.md)
* [科学上网的正确姿势](/other/科学上网的正确姿势.md)
12 changes: 4 additions & 8 deletions blog/docker-compose教程.md
Original file line number Diff line number Diff line change
Expand Up @@ -6,8 +6,7 @@ compose项目是官方的开源项目,负责实现对docker镜像集群的快

compose重要的两个概念

服务(service):一个应用的容器,可以包含多个相同镜像运行的容器
项目(project):由一组关联的应用容器组成的完整单元,在docker-compose.yml中定义
服务(service):一个应用的容器,可以包含多个相同镜像运行的容器 项目(project):由一组关联的应用容器组成的完整单元,在docker-compose.yml中定义

## 安装及使用

Expand All @@ -26,9 +25,9 @@ compose的命令对象大部分是项目本身,也可以指定项目中的服
version: "3"
#定义服务
services:
#服务名称
#服务名称
webapp:
#镜像名称
#镜像名称
image: examples/web
#暴露的端口
ports:
Expand All @@ -40,10 +39,9 @@ services:
也可以通过build指定dockerfile文件自动构建镜像
```yml
```yaml
version: '3'
services:

webapp:
build:
context: ./dir
Expand All @@ -60,6 +58,4 @@ services:

- `cammand`:指定容器启动后执行的命令



## 常用命令
10 changes: 4 additions & 6 deletions blog/harbor教程.md
Original file line number Diff line number Diff line change
@@ -1,4 +1,5 @@
# 使用harbor搭建docker私有仓库

> 一般公司都有自己docker私有仓库,而harbor就是其中之一,下面教你使用harbor搭建私有的docker仓库
## 环境准备
Expand All @@ -8,6 +9,7 @@
- Openssl : Latest is preferred

## 安装

harbor可以在线安装和离线安装,不过方法都一样

- [下载harbor安装包](https://github.com/goharbor/harbor/releases) 在线或者离线都可以
Expand All @@ -23,6 +25,7 @@ curl -LJO https://github.com/goharbor/harbor/releases/download/v2.2.1/harbor-onl
~~~shell
tar xvf harbor-online-installer-version.tgz
~~~

或者

~~~shell
Expand All @@ -33,12 +36,10 @@ tar xvf harbor-offline-installer-version.tgz

![harbor](../images/harbor.png)


- 修改配置文件,修改域名、端口、https证书配置、默认密码等

![harbor-yml](../images/harbor-yml.png)


- 以管理员的身份执行install.sh

~~~shell
Expand All @@ -57,16 +58,14 @@ sudo ./install.sh

![harbor-home](../images/harbor-home2.png)


## 开始上传镜像到harbor

!> 如果你使用的是http协议,那需要在docker的配置文件中增加所信任的http地址

`"insecure-registries"`属性中,增加你的harbor地址,然后重启docker

如:
` "insecure-registries": ["http://域名:端口"] `

` "insecure-registries": ["http://域名:端口"] `

- 登陆到你的harbor

Expand All @@ -92,5 +91,4 @@ docker tag source:tag target:tag

![harbor2](../images/harbor3.png)


其他配置可以详细查看[官方文档](https://goharbor.io/)
11 changes: 4 additions & 7 deletions blog/portainer教程.md
Original file line number Diff line number Diff line change
Expand Up @@ -2,12 +2,10 @@

> docker的一款GUI的管理工具,支持对docker进行启动、停止、部署、删除等等操作,界面美观,功能强大

## 部署

部署非常简单,拉取portainer镜像,运行即可,[docker hub文档](https://hub.docker.com/r/portainer/portainer)


- linux部署

~~~shell
Expand All @@ -24,13 +22,12 @@ docker run -d -p 8000:8000 -p 9000:9000 --name=portainer --restart=always -v /va

window部署请看[window](https://documentation.portainer.io/v2.0/deploy/ceinstalldocker/)

- 启动成功访问 http://localhost:9000 出现管理界面,第一次需要你设置密码

- 启动成功访问 http://localhost:9000 出现管理界面,第一次需要你设置密码

![portainer](../images/portainer.png)
![portainer](../images/portainer.png)

管理docker容器
![portainer2](../images/portainer2.png)
![portainer2](../images/portainer2.png)

管理docker镜像
![portainer-iamges](../images/portainer-images.png)
![portainer-iamges](../images/portainer-images.png)
15 changes: 8 additions & 7 deletions blog/rocketMQ入门教程.md
Original file line number Diff line number Diff line change
@@ -1,13 +1,14 @@
# RocketMQ入门教程

## 概述
了解rocketmq基础知识,请看我的 [rocketMQ学习](../notes/rocketMQ.md),或者移步到rocketmq的github地址 https://github.com/apache/rocketmq/tree/master/docs/cn
## 概述

了解rocketmq基础知识,请看我的 [rocketMQ学习](../notes/rocketMQ.md)
,或者移步到rocketmq的github地址 https://github.com/apache/rocketmq/tree/master/docs/cn

## 支持的特性
## 支持的特性

- 发布-订阅
- 顺序消费
- 消息过滤
- 消息可靠性
- 发布-订阅
- 顺序消费
- 消息过滤
- 消息可靠性

3 changes: 2 additions & 1 deletion foreword/介绍.md
Original file line number Diff line number Diff line change
@@ -1,7 +1,8 @@
# 介绍

!> 📘个人的学习笔记,对Java开发过程中的知识点做总结,也希望对你有所帮助,学如逆水行舟,不进则退,你知道的越多,你不知道的越多,希望大家专心练剑

?> 本人目前从事java开发两年,菜鸟一枚,如果文章有错误的地方请指正,自己当初也是从小白一步步摸索过来,踩了许多坑,希望对你有所帮助,如果你觉得还不错,请给作者点个赞吧👍
?> 本人目前从事java开发两年,菜鸟一枚,如果文章有错误的地方请指正,自己当初也是从小白一步步摸索过来,踩了许多坑,希望对你有所帮助,如果你觉得还不错,请给作者点个赞吧👍

---

Expand Down
Loading

0 comments on commit 550c048

Please sign in to comment.